Python/Basic
-
4-2. Python 기본 문법 (산술, 비교, 논리 연산)Python/Basic 2019. 4. 2. 19:10
4.2. Python 기본 문법 (산술, 비교, 논리 연산) 파이썬에서는 산술, 비교, 할당, 비트, 논리 연산자가 제공되어 사용할 수 있다. 1. 산술 연산 덧셈: + 뺄셈: - 곱셈: * 나누기: / (소수점 포함), // (소수점 제거) 나머지: % 제곱: ** 결과 확인 2. 비교 연산 관계 연산자는 참과 거짓인 True와 False로 값을 반환한다. 관계 연산자 의미 A > B A가 B보다 크다. A >= B A가 B보다 크거나 같다. A == B A와 B가 같다. A != B A와 B는 다르다. 결과 확인 3. 논리 연산 논리 연산은 Boolean값을 입력받아 연산 결과를 True나 False로 반환해준다. 3-1 and: 논리 연산에서는 곱의 연산이다. 모두 참일때만 참을 뜻한다. 입력 값 ..
-
4-1. Python 기본 문법 (변수와 자료형)Python/Basic 2019. 3. 27. 23:24
4-1. Python 기본 문법 (변수와 자료형) 1. 변수 프로그래밍 언어를 배울 때 가장 기초가 되면서도 중요한 "변수"라는 개념이 있다. 변수는 '변할 수 있는 값 또는 정보'란 뜻으로, 프로그램을 할 때 특정 숫자나 문자를 담아두는 공간이라 생각할 수 있다. 일반적으로, 변수(상자)에 특정 값을 할당하면(담으면) 그 값은 계속 수정 가능하다. 이해가기 쉽게 var이라는 변수 안에 값인 5를 담는 것으로 표현했지만 실제로 변수는 5라는 값이 있는 메모리를 가리킨다고 볼 수 있다. 변수명을 정할 때는 1) 영문자나 _(언더스코어)로 시작해야 한다. 2) 대문자와 소문자는 구분되어 다른 변수로 저장된다. ex. Python과 python은 다른 변수다. 3) 파이썬의 예약어로 사용되는 이름은 변수로 사..
-
3. Python 사용법Python/Basic 2019. 3. 26. 23:37
3. Python 사용법 이번 포스팅에서는 파이썬을 사용하는 방법에 대해 설명해보려 한다. 1. Python IDLE(Integrated Development and Learning Environment) 파이썬 설치시 같이 설치되는 프로그램으로 처음 파이썬이 어떤 언어인지 경험할 떄 사용해보면 좋다. 1-1키보드의 윈도우키 + 키보드 R키를 눌러 실행창을 켜고 IDLE를 입력한다. 1-2처음 실행시 작동되는 프로그램의 이름을 보면 Python 3.x.x Shell 이라고 적혀있는 걸 볼 수있다.Shell은 IDLE를 이용하는 방법 두 가지 중 하나로, 파이썬과 대화하는 형식으로 한 줄씩 입력하면 바로 출력값이 보인다.파이썬과 대화를 하는 것처럼 주고 받는 느낌으로 파이썬을 이용해 볼 수 있다. 1-3I..
-
2. Python 설치 (windows)Python/Basic 2019. 3. 8. 13:14
2. Python 설치 (windows) 파이썬을 설치하는 데는 크게 두 가지 방법이 있다. 1. 파이썬 공식 홈페이지를 통해 다운받는 방법 2. Anaconda(아나콘다)를 통해 파이썬 배포판을 설치하는 방법 두 가지 방법의 차이점이라면1번의 경우 기본의 파이썬 자체를 다운받는다고 생각하면 되고, 필요한 툴들(pandas, numpy 등..)은 pip을 이용해서 추가 설치가 가능하다. 2번의 경우 아나콘다라는 패키지를 설치하면 그 안에 파이썬과 여러 툴들(jupyter, spyder, pandas, numpy, sckitlearn 등..)이미리 설치되어 있어 편리하다. 데이터 사이언스를 하는 사람들의 경우나 처음 파이썬을 접하는 사람의 경우보통 아나콘다를 설치하여 간편하게 사용하는 경우가 많고 아나콘다..
-
1. Python?Python/Basic 2019. 3. 3. 22:24
Python? [이미지 출처: 구글 검색] Python은 데이터의 중요성이 점차 부각되면서, 데이터 사이언스의 분석도구로 전통적인 R과 함께 많은 인기를 차지하고 있다. 데이터 사이언스의 도구로써만 파이썬이 인기가 많은 것은 아니다.그 이외에도, 파이썬이 가진 여러 장점들이 있는데 나는 파이썬의 가장 큰 장점을 "편리함"이라고 말하고 싶다. 먼저 파이썬에 대해 간략히 설명해보자면, 정의는 다음과 같다.1991년 귀도 반 로섬에 의해 만들어진 고급 언어로 플랫폼 독립적이며 인터프리터식, 객체지향적, 동적 타이핑(dynamically typed) 대화형 언어이다. [출처: 위키백과]나는 내가 사용하면서 느낀 장점들로 파이썬을 이해해보려 한다. 정의와 별개로, 내가 느낀 파이썬의 장점은 첫 째, 문법이 간단하..